Numbers 9:22 - Easy To Read Version

22 If the cloud stayed over the Holy Tent for two days, or a month, or a year, the people continued to obey the Lord. They stayed at that place and did not leave until the cloud moved. Then when the cloud rose from its place and moved, the people also moved.
